ABB

ABB is the world’s leading provider of transmission and distribution equipment for the power grid and renewable energy sources, including grid modernization (the “smart grid”). It is also a leader in automation products and process automation systems, providing both its power and automation customers with greater energy efficiency, grid reliability and industrial productivity.

ABB’s North American headquarters is located in Cary, and the company’s U.S. Corporate Research Center is located in Raleigh at North Carolina State University’s Centennial Campus, with a focus on electric power grid reliability and availability, transmission and distribution system solutions and grid capability optimization and asset management. The ABB Cary office was selected to house the ABB Human Resources Service Center and the ABB Shared Accounting Services, the new headquarters for all human resources and accounting services functions for all employees in the United States.

In September 2011, the company announced that it would build a new manufacturing facility in Huntersville, a $90 million investment.  ABB plans to manufacture high-voltage land cables for power transmission at the Huntersville factory.
